Documentos de Académico
Documentos de Profesional
Documentos de Cultura
UTPL
Tema:
Resolución de ejercicios mediante pseudocódigo y diagrama
de flujo
Alumno:
Fabián Andrés Ochoa Bustamante
Realizar un pseudocódigo y diagrama de flujo para determinar el Máximo Común Divisor (MCD)
Pseudocódigo:
Num1, Num2, a, b, c
Inicio
Leer Num1
Leer
Num2
Si (Num1>Num2){
Num1=a
Num2=b
}Si no{
Num2=a
Num1=b
}
Si (a/b==0)
{ Respuesta
=b Print b
}Si no{
Mod(a/b)
(aMODb)=z
b/z
}while(b/z)=0{
b=a
z=b
respuesta=z
Fin
Inicio
1 (a MOD b)=z (b/z)==0
Respuesta=z
Num1,
Num2, a, b, c NO
(a/b)==0 b=a
z
z
SI
Num1
Respuesta=b
z=b
Num2
b
SI
Num1>Num2 Num1=a Num2=
NO Fin
Num2=a
Num1=b
1
Realizar un pseudocódigo y diagrama de flujo para determinar el mínimo común múltiplo (mcm)
Pseudocódigo:
Num1, Num2, a, b, c
Inicio
Leer Num1
Leer
Num2
Si (Num1>Num2){
Num1=a
Num2=b
}Si no{
Num2=a
Num1=b
}{
mcm(a, b)
mcm(a, b)=c (a/c)*b
Respuesta=(a/c)*b
Print b
Fin
Inicio
1
Num1,
Num2, a, b, c
mcm(a,b)
Num1
mcm(a,b)=c
Num2
(a/c)*b
SI
Num1>Num2 Num1=a Num=b
(a/c)*b=respuesta
NO
Num2=a
Respuesta
Num1=b
Fin
1
Realizar un pseudocódigo para determinar si un número es primo o no lo es.
Pseudocódigo:
A=1, B=0
Inicio
LeerX
While (A<=X){
Si (X/a)==0
B+=1
}Si no{
A+=1
} Si {
B==2
Print Es número primo
}Si no{
Print No es número primo
Fin
Inicio
A=1, B=0
A<=x x/A==0
B+=1
No es número
primo
Es número
primo
Fin
Realizar un pseudocódigo y diagrama de flujo para determinar la serie de números Fibonacci
Pseudocódigo:
A=0, B=1, con=1
Inicio
LeerX
While
con<=X
C=A+B
A=B
B=C
con+1
print C
Fin
Inicio
C=A+B
A=B
B=C
con+1
con>=X C
Fin